Shielding Your Balance from Adjustments

Electric balances are sensitive to various features in temperature and humidity. These adaptations can cause stretch or shrink of the materials in the balance, resulting in incorrect weight measurements. Keep your balance away from direct sunlight, heat and high-humidity areas to prevent this. When you store your balance in a steady and controlled environment you can help protect it from these fluctuations.
